Behind The Lens
Location
This photo was taken at the Eco Park near my home in Stayner, ON. It's a great little spot to try and capture images of nature and wildlife.Time
I had gone for a walk with a friend of mine in the evening. It was late summer so we wanted to get out after the high heat of the day. This picture was taken just before sunset, before the light disappeared from the shadows of the treeline.Lighting
I love shooting landscape and nature right at the golden hour. It makes the images warm and inviting, and gives them a feel of peacefulness.Equipment
This was a handheld shot on a Canon EOS Rebel T5, with a 75-300mm zoom lens.Inspiration
We had been walking through the park for some time, and had taken probably 100 other photos before this one. When we came out to a clearing and I saw this field of grass and the setting sun casting its golden rays out across it, I knew I had to do a low angle shot through the grass.Editing
I did very little post processing to this image. Most of the work was done in the camera.In my camera bag
I have a handy little sling pack that I take everywhere with me. It always has my Canon T5 in it, a 75-300mm zoom lens, a 18-55mm kit lens, and my 50mm 1.8. I never know what I'm going to shoot, so better to have some options!Feedback
Take advantage of the golden hour. It is truly a magical time of day for photography!!!
